New Brockton, AL D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is a thorough health evaluation necessitated by the Department of Transportation for every commercial motor vehicle operator. This checkup confirms that these drivers are capable physically, mentally, and emotionally to handle large vehicles on highways. Conducted by a certified medical examiner listed on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ners, passing this assessment grants a DOT medical certificate, necessary for keeping a valid CDL as per F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review of medical history and medication assessment
  • Eye test (corrective eyewear permissible; minimum norms apply)
  • Hearing test (forced whisper test or audiometric assessment)
  • Check blood pressure and pulse
  • Physical exam (system review)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You are required to hold a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Possess a commercial driver's license (CDL) in class A, B, or C for interstate trade
  • Drive vehicles exceeding 10,001 lbs. Gross Vehicle Weight Rating in interstate trade
  • Transport more than 8 for-hire or over 15 non-hire passengers
  • Carry hazardous materials needing DOT placards
  • Are employed by DOT-regulated entities such as F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A, or USCG where DOT medical clearance is essential

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Vision less than 20/40 in each eye (with correction), trouble distinguishing traffic signal colors, or hearing loss that prevents recognizing a forced whisper at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Unmanaged hypertension (≥180/110 mmHg), recent heart attack, stroke, uncontrolled angina, or an implanted defibrillator without approval.
  • Diabetes: Uncontrolled diabetes with frequent hypoglycemia or complications (neuropathy, vision impairment) affecting safe dri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Issues: Untreated obstructive sleep apnea causing daytime sleepiness, or severe respiratory diseases affecting oxygen levels.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y or uncontrolled seizure disorders (unless exempted), conditions causing unexpected consciousness loss, dizziness, or uncontrolled tremors.
  • Substance Abuse: Use of illicit drugs, alcohol dependence, or misuse of medications impairing driving abilities.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Disorders: Severe untreated psychiatric illnesses (e.g., schizophrenia, bipolar disorder with recent episodes) or cognitive impairments affecting judgment and response time.

Temporary issues may temporarily disqualify you until you provide the necessary medical clearance or documentation (e.g., controlled blood pressure, diabetes management). Other conditions, such as untreated seizure disorders or implanted defibrillators, are usually considered permanently disqualifying according to FMCSA rules.

Frequently Asked Questions

A DOT physical typically includes a review of the driver’s health history and medications, vision screening, hearing assessment, vital signs (blood pressure, pulse), urinalysis (checking specific gravity, protein, glucose), and a full physical examination by a certified medical examiner. Upon passing, a Medical Examiner’s Certificate (DOT medical card) may be issued for up to 24 months.
You must have a valid DOT medical certificate if you: hold a commercial driver’s license (CDL) Class A, B or C for interstate commerce; operate a vehicle over 10,001 lbs GVWR in interstate commerce; transport more than eight passengers (for hire) or over fifteen passengers (not for hire); or transport hazardous materials requiring placarding under DOT regulations.

You should bring a government-issued photo ID; glasses or contact lenses and the prescription; a list of medications and dosages; CPAP usage data if applicable; and any specialist clearance letters or physician documentation (for conditions like heart disease, sleep apnea, diabetes) to your DOT physical.
If you fail the DOT physical, you will not receive the medical card; you may be temporarily or permanently disqualified depending on the condition; you will need to address any medical issues (e.g., uncontrolled hypertension, untreated sleep apnea, recent myocardial infarction) and then be re-examined.
